Adventure World launches 2020 India, Sri Lanka, Nepal collection

With strong demand for heritage and cultural activities across India, Adventure World Travel is now offering more immersive journeys for 2020, including Wildlife of North India itinerary, which now includes a visit to Wildlife SOS’s elephant rescue centre near Agra; and the 10-day Rajasthan’s Cultural Heritage itinerary, which includes unique and fascinating places to stay – from royal homes and estates to cliff-top forts.

“Our travellers have continually expressed interest in the remote areas of the northeast India and it’s tribal states and with these areas now more accessible with the recent opening of land border crossings between the Indian states – we’re excited to provide our guests with the opportunity to truly explore the regions and tailor-make each trip so its their own,” says Neil Rodgers, Adventure World Travel Managing Director.

As a partner of The TreadRight Foundation, guests can see firsthand the work that Wildlife SOS undertakes to help elephants living in urban environments that have been wounded, malnourished and dehydrated. The itinerary also includes two of northwest India’s most important national parks, Corbett and Ranthambhore – each providing vastly different habitat and wildlife viewing opportunities.

Aligning with the brand’s sustainable message, the new brochures are printed on 100% recyclable paper.
